There are 195 countries in the world. Out of those 195 only 1 is named after a women. St Lucia is the only country in the world named after a woman. This year for International Women’s day wanted to give back and with the gender pay gap at 18.4% it felt only fitting that all women were given 18.4% off all flights and hotels to St Lucia.